Makassar to Bengkulu

Updated: 28 May 2026

The most practical way to travel from Makassar to Bengkulu is by air. You will fly from Sultan Hasanuddin International Airport to Fatmawati Soekarno Airport, usually with a transit in Jakarta. Bengkulu is the capital of Bengkulu province and is known for its historic sites and beautiful beaches. This route connects the eastern part of Indonesia to the western coast of Sumatra. Expect a travel time of around 6 hours including the layover.

Total Distance: 2,000 km straight-line air distance.
Fastest Way
Full-service airline flight with a short transit in Jakarta, totaling 6 hours.
Cheapest Way
Booking a connecting flight with a budget airline at least three weeks in advance.

Things to Do in Bengkulu
1
Fort Marlborough
Visit this historic British fort, which is one of the largest in Southeast Asia.
2
Panjang Beach
Relax on this long, beautiful beach, which is popular for surfing and sunset views.
3
Soekarno's Exile House
Learn about the history of Indonesia's first president at this preserved house.
